KARACHI: A meeting of the Steering Committee of the Education Department was held under the chairmanship of Sindh Education Minister Syed Sardar Ali Shah and made key decisions regarding the commencement of the new academic year, the academic calendar, examinations, holidays, school timings, and other important educational matters. Minister for Universities and Boards, Ismail Rahu, attended the meeting as a special participant.

It was decided that the new academic year in Sindh will commence on April 1, 2026.

The year 2026 will be observed as “Teach for Trees” to promote awareness among students about tree plantation and environmental protection.

As Chairman of the Steering Committee, Education Minister Syed Sardar Ali Shah directed that children should be encouraged to plant trees within schools or designated areas and take responsibility for their care, with the aim of making schools more child-friendly and environmentally sustainable. Expressing satisfaction over the implementation of decisions taken in the previous academic year, the Minister emphasized the need to further strengthen effective implementation of the academic calendar.

He stated that 2025 was observed as the year of STEAM Education in Sindh, which yielded positive results.

He added that if approximately ten million students in Sindh plant one tree each, ten million new trees could be grown across the province.

The Steering Committee decided that examinations up to Grade 8 will be conducted in March as usual, including during the month of Ramadan.

Examinations for Grades 9 and 10 will be held from March 31 to April 15, 2026, while examinations for Grades 11 and 12 will take place from April 15 to April 30, 2026.

The committee also approved that Intermediate results will be announced from June 1.

It was further decided that summer vacations in the new academic year will be observed during June and July, while winter vacations will be held in the last ten days of December.

In view of climate change, a sub-committee of the Steering Committee will be formed to consult all stakeholders and present recommendations regarding possible adjustments to the holiday schedule, which may be considered for the academic year 2027.

The meeting directed authorities to ensure timely conduct of board examinations and avoid any delay in the announcement of results.

All educational boards were instructed to implement the Optical Mark Recognition (OMR) system to enhance transparency and improve examination outcomes.

Provincial Minister for Universities and Boards Ismail Rahu also directed board chairmen to increase the use of technology in examination processes to minimize human involvement and improve result efficiency.
